Abstract
Makanan Bergizi Gratis (MBG) Program is an Indonesian government initiative that provides nutritionally balanced meals to elementary school children to improve nutritional status and support healthy dietary habits. The primary goal of this research was to assess variations in nutritional metrics and dietary quality between children who received MBG and those who did not in Jakarta. A cross-sectional study was conducted among 105 children aged 9–12 years from SD Negeri Malaka Sari 04 and SDIT AR-RIDHO using stratified random sampling and comparative statistical analysis. Univariate analysis revealed that the prevalence of normal nutritional status was 60% among students at SD Negeri Malaka Sari 04, which implemented the MBG program, compared with 50,5% among students at SDIT AR-RIDHO, which did not implement the program. Furthermore, the mean dietary quality scores were 62,35% and 62,86% for SD Negeri Malaka Sari 04 and SDIT AR-RIDHO, respectively. However, the bivariate analysis found no significant differences in nutritional status or dietary quality between children attending schools with and without the MBG program (p= 0,128; p= 0,272).
